#216894 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#216894 is composed of 12.9% red, 40.8%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.7% cyan, 29.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 203 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 35.5%. #216894 color hex could be obtained by blending #42d0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#216894 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#216894 has RGB values of R:33, G:104,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2189460.

Shades and Tints of #216894
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010304 is the darkest color, while #f3f9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#216894
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595b5c is the less saturated color, while #056fb0 is the most saturated one.
